The Nagaland government has formed a Special Investigation Team (SIT) to probe into the firing incident that took place on Saturday evening in Mon district that led to the killing of 14 civilians.
The Nagaland government on Sunday set up a Special Investigation Team (SIT) to probe into the firing incident in which 14 civilians were killed in an area between Tiru and Oting village in Mon district involving security forces.
In an order issued by the state home department signed by Chief Secretary J Alam, it said that there were firing incidents on Saturday in an area between Tiru and Oting village involving security forces in which 14 civilians died and many others were injured. One security personnel was also killed in the incident.
